Ouch! Yall have a tough time! On Friday I am buying a Texas Resident Lifetime Hunting and Fishing License. It will set me back a Grand but then for the rest of my life they will just swipe my drivers license and print me out a hunting license. Here in Texas that's good for 5 whitetail(not more than 3 bucks), 4 turkey, 2 mule deer (1 buck), and all the wild boar a man can toss a bullet at, every year, for the rest of my life. And that"s not even getting into migratory birds or fishing. I would go stir crazy having to wait around to see if I could hunt based on a lottery system.
